Medicinal Use*:
Turmeric has many medicinal properties and many
in South Asia use it as a readily available
antiseptic for cuts, burns and bruises. It is
also used as an antibacterial agent.
It is taken in some Asian
countries as a dietary supplement, which
allegedly helps with stomach problems and other
ailments. It is popular as a tea in Okinawa,
Japan. Pakistanis also use it as an
anti-inflammatory agent, and remedy for
gastrointestinal discomfort associated with
irritable bowel syndrome, and other digestive
disorders. Turmeric is also applied to a wound
to cleanse and stimulate recovery. Turmeric can
be used to flush toxins from the liver . When
applied externally, it can reduce the appearance
of scars and help alleviate inflammation,
stiffness and pain in the joints.
